Accident Reconstruction Harlan Co. Man Dies After Colliding With Semi

A Harlan County man, who suffered critical injuries during a January 16 collision in Perry County, has died.

The accident happened around 12:30 p.m. on Highway 699 in the Cornettsville community.

Investigators determined that Scottie Cornett, age 40 of Cumberland, KY, was traveling eastbound on HWY 699, when he lost control of his 2009 Chevrolet Cobalt.  While attempting to regain control of the vehicle, Cornett struck a 1994 Peterbilt.

Cornett was ejected from the vehicle and thrown over an embankment. He was taken to UK hospital where he succumbed to his injuries.

The driver of the semi was not injured.
